• oil filter – stainless steel edible oil filter machine in Zambia
  • oil filter – stainless steel edible oil filter machine in Zambia
  • oil filter – stainless steel edible oil filter machine in Zambia
  • oil filter – stainless steel edible oil filter machine in Zambia